**ValidGate account recovery.** Scope: plugin registry accounts only. Verify requester identity via two approved channels. Disable active validator plugins before reset. Re-issue credentials through the Korvet console, never by chat. Confirm the user can load the schema-check plugin post-reset. If the console itself is locked out, escalate to the duty lead and use the passphrase below.

unlock words, yagag-yahog: gordor-zorvan-druius-queniel-normir-norwyn-framir-novmir-ralius-holwyn-wenwyn-tamael-silok-holdor

### Escalation: Snapshot Test Failures

If snapshot tests for the Thistledown component library start failing on main, don't just re-record them — that hides real regressions. First check whether a recent theme or token change explains the diff. If the diffs look unrelated or flaky, ping the design-systems channel and hold your merge. Still stuck after an hour? Escalate to the frontend platform leads at the address below.

alerts address for kajog-tadup: druox@plorvanet.internal

## TICKET-4182 — Signature check failed on nightly reindex plugin

The nightly search reindex on Lanternquery rejected several third-party plugins last night with signature verification errors. Cause: we rotated the platform signing key on Tuesday, and plugins signed against the old key no longer validate. Plugin authors should re-sign their packages and resubmit before the next reindex window. To verify your builds match, the current signing key is provided below.

deploy key for kajof-fajop: bky6_gDHw9Q

## Onboarding: Vendoring Third-Party Fonts

At Pellamore we vendor all third-party fonts into the `assets/fonts` tree rather than loading them from external hosts. This keeps builds reproducible and avoids license drift — every vendored font must include its license file and an entry in the font manifest, reviewed by the design-systems group. The manifest itself lives in an encrypted archive so license terms can't be edited casually. To open that archive during your first vendoring task, you will need the recovery passphrase shown below.

vault phrase of bagaf-kajeg = jorath-feniel-briir-siliel-ralix